日期类型的基本概念
在MySQL中,日期类型主要有三种:DATE、TIME和DATETIME。其中,DATE用于表示日期,格式为YYYY-MM-DD;TIME用于表示时间,格式为HH:MM:SS;DATETIME用于表示日期和时间,格式为YYYY-MM-DD HH:MM:SS。使用日期类型的好处是可以方便地进行日期计算、比较等操作。
二级标题一:按年份查询
如果大家想查询某一年的数据,可以使用YEAR()函数。查询的数据:
n) = ;
n列中所有年份为的数据。YEAR()函数可以提取日期中的年份信息。
二级标题二:按月份查询
如果大家想查询某一月份的数据,可以使用MONTH()函数。查询1月的数据:
nn) = 1;
n列中所有年份为,月份为1的数据。MONTH()函数可以提取日期中的月份信息。
二级标题三:按日期范围查询
如果大家想查询某一日期范围内的数据,可以使用BETWEEN…AND…语句。查询1月1日到1月31日的数据:
n BETWEEN ‘-01-01’ AND ‘-01-31’;
n列中所有日期在1月1日到1月31日之间的数据。
二级标题四:按日期格式查询
m-dd的数据:
n-%d’) = ‘-01-01’;
nm-dd格式的数据。
通过以上四种技巧,大家可以方便地实现MySQL日期类型的模糊查询。在实际应用中,大家可以根据具体情况选择不同的查询方式,以提高查询效率。同时,为了保证数据的准确性和一致性,大家还需要注意日期格式的统一和合法性。